Architecte Applicatif Kafka - Expert - Freelance
Freelance Lille (Nord)
Description de l'offre
Contexte
Historiquement décentralisé et hétérogène, l'équipe évolue vers un modèle de plateformes mutualisées pour améliorer la gouvernance et harmoniser les usages. L'objectif est de passer d'une gestion d'infrastructure à une approche « Produit », où Kafka devient un service fluide, gouverné et optimisé pour l'ensemble du groupe.
Dans une équipe composée de 2 ingénieurs DevOps Kafka (5 ingénieurs à partir de septembre), en tant qu’architecte applicatif Kafka, la mission principale est d'accompagner cette transformation.
Missions
Architecture et stratégie
Définir et porter l’architecture cible de Kafka
Concevoir le modèle de Mutualized Cluster et l'offre Topic as a Service
Établir la roadmap technique en cohérence
Expérience utilisateur
Définir avec les utilisateurs et la communauté d'ingénieurs les usages sur Kafka
Définir les parcours utilisateurs en adéquation avec les cas d’usages
Delivery et expertise technique
Implémenter les nouvelles fonctionnalités dans la stack technique digitale (3S)
Assurer la migration transparente des environnements vers les dernières versions (3.9 et +)
Développer et maintenir les composants de l'écosystème (Java, Python, Terraform)
Gouvernance et leadership
Contribuer activement à la gouvernance globale (TechRadar, Matrice de maturité…)
Évangéliser les bonnes pratiques au sein de la communauté d'ingénieurs
Suivre l'analyse des coûts (FinOps) pour driver l'optimisation des ressources
Outils & Environnement
Kafka et les outils périphériques (Kafka Connect, Kafka MirrorMaker, Kafka UI...)
Cloud : GCP, AWS, Aiven
Développement : Java, Python
Tooling : Github, Github Actions, Kubernetes, Terraform, Flux
Outils collaboratifs : Confluence, Jira
Monitoring : Datadog
Objectifs et livrables
Définition de l'architecture technique cible
Définition des bonnes pratiques sur Kafka
Contribution à la définition des règles de gouvernance
Participation active à la communauté « SIG Streaming »
Définition des objectifs de l’équipe, définition et suivi de la roadmap
Conseil et accompagnement des équipes utilisatrices de Kafka
Développement des composants dans l'écosystème Kafka et maintien des composants existants (Java, Terraform, Python...)
Suivi des coûts d'usage de Kafka et proposition d’optimisations #finops
Accompagnement et montée en compétence de l'équipe sur Kafka, faire le lien avec l'API Management
Partage des nouveautés et bonnes pratiques autour du data streaming #veille
Conditions de travail
Localisation : Lille
Profil recherché
- Expertise Kafka dont Kafka Connect, MirrorMaker, et idéalement l'opérateur Strimzi
- Développement en Java pour la maintenance de certains composants
- Culture Cloud & Automation : Maîtrise des environnements cloud (GCP, AWS, Aiven) et du GitOps (Terraform, Flux)
- Leadership : capacité à "tracter" des sujets complexes, à convaincre des parties prenantes variées et à vulgariser
- Esprit “Produit” : une sensibilité forte à l'expérience développeur (DevEx)
À propos de Collective.work
Collective.work est la plateforme de recrutement nouvelle génération pour trouver votre prochain emploi.
Fort d'une grande expertise dans l'IA, Collective.work permet de mieux cibler les offres et leurs candidats correspondants, créant ainsi un système beaucoup plus fluide que les acteurs traditionnels.
Plus de 10,000 recruteurs utilisent Collective, permettant à des dizaines de milliers de candidats de trouver leur futur emploi chaque jours